Place parentheses in the expression so it simplifies to 30.5•7-3+2

As understand you need to get 30 by placing parenthesis in the expression:

  • 5*7 - 3 + 2

There are two ways I can think of.

1) The 5*7 is 35 so we can subtract 5 to get 30:

  • 5*7 - (3 + 2) = 35 - 5 = 30

2) Another way is 5*6 = 30 and it is achieved as:

  • 5*(7 - 3 + 2) = 5*6 = 30
